Overview

Interdisciplinary position in policy, advocacy, and/or disability studies and speech, language and hearing sciences: We are searching for someone to teach in and help us build an innovative interdisciplinary certificate at the forefront of disability/access policy and advocacy, in advance of a new related Master’s of Public Health degree program. The successful candidate will have expertise to teach courses in Speech, Language, and Hearing Sciences as well as courses with a focus in disability studies, policy, or advocacy at the undergraduate and graduate levels. About UMass Amherst

UMass Amherst, the Commonwealth's flagship campus, is a nationally ranked public research university offering a full range of undergraduate, graduate and professional degrees. The University sits on nearly 1,450-acres in the scenic Pioneer Valley of Western Massachusetts and offers a rich cultural environment in a bucolic setting close to major urban centers. In addition, the University is part of the Five Colleges (including Amherst College, Hampshire College, Mount Holyoke College, and Smith College), which adds to the intellectual energy of the region.
